Located on the banks of the Ohio River, Ambridge is a former steel town about 16 miles northwest of Pittsburgh. First settled in the early 19th century, Ambridge contains a rich history. Ambridge residents and visitors can immerse themselves in the area’s past at Old Economy Village, a living testament to the Harmony Society.
Ambridge boasts a small-town atmosphere, filled with historic buildings, quaint antique stores, and four public parks. Regular public events are held to foster community engagement throughout the year, from the farmers market to holiday parades and everything in between. Convenient access to Route 65 makes getting around from Ambridge easy.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
